Common misconceptions: One common misconception is confusing percentage increase/decrease with absolute changes. For example, a 10% increase followed by a 10% decrease does not result in the original number. Another is misinterpreting “percent change” – is it a percentage of the original value or the final value? The standard is always the original value. Also, people sometimes struggle with converting percentages to decimals or fractions correctly, which is the first step in most percentage calculations.
Percentage Calculation Formula and Mathematical Explanation
The core idea behind calculating a percentage of a total value is to determine what portion that value represents out of one hundred parts of the total. The standard formula is derived from this definition.
Step-by-Step Derivation
- Convert Percentage to Decimal: To use a percentage in a calculation, you first need to convert it into its decimal form. This is done by dividing the percentage value by 100. For example, 15% becomes 15 / 100 = 0.15.
- Multiply by the Total Value: Once you have the decimal representation of the percentage, you multiply it by the total value you are interested in. This operation isolates the portion of the total that corresponds to the given percentage.
Combining these steps gives us the primary formula:
Percentage Amount = (Percentage Value / 100) * Total Value

Practical Examples (Real-World Use Cases)
Example 1: Calculating a Discount
Imagine you want to buy a product that costs $80, and it’s on sale for 25% off. You need to calculate how much money you’ll save.
- Total Value: $80
- Percentage Value: 25%
Using the formula:
Discount Amount = (25 / 100) * $80 = 0.25 * $80 = $20
Interpretation: You will save $20 on the purchase. The final price would be $80 – $20 = $60.
Example 2: Calculating Sales Tax
You are buying an item for $150, and the sales tax rate is 7%. You need to figure out the total amount you’ll pay, including tax.
- Total Value (Pre-Tax): $150
- Percentage Value (Tax Rate): 7%
First, calculate the tax amount:
Tax Amount = (7 / 100) * $150 = 0.07 * $150 = $10.50
Then, add the tax amount to the original price to find the total cost:
Total Cost = Original Price + Tax Amount = $150 + $10.50 = $160.50
Interpretation: You will pay $160.50 in total for the item, with $10.50 being the sales tax.

Key Factors That Affect Percentage Results
While the calculation itself is straightforward, the context and the numbers you input significantly influence the outcome and its interpretation. Several factors are critical:
- Base Value (Total Value): This is the most crucial factor. The same percentage applied to different base values will yield vastly different results. A 10% increase on $100 ($10) is much smaller than a 10% increase on $1000 ($100). Always ensure you are using the correct base value for your calculation.
- The Percentage Itself: Obviously, a higher percentage will result in a larger portion of the total. Understanding whether you’re dealing with small fractions (e.g., 0.5%) or large portions (e.g., 75%) is key.
- Percentage Point vs. Percentage Change: Be mindful of the difference. A change from 10% to 12% is a 2 percentage point increase, but it’s a 20% increase relative to the original 10% ( (12-10)/10 * 100 ). This distinction is vital in financial reporting and analysis.
- Growth and Decay Rates: In finance, percentages often represent growth (interest, appreciation) or decay (depreciation, inflation). Understanding whether the percentage is applied additively or multiplicatively over time (as in compound interest) significantly changes the final outcome.
- Fees and Additional Costs: When calculating things like loan amounts or investment returns, hidden fees, service charges, or administrative costs can effectively alter the ‘total value’ or reduce the final percentage gain. Always account for any deductions or additions.
- Inflation: When dealing with long-term financial planning or comparing historical figures, inflation erodes purchasing power. A 5% annual return might sound good, but if inflation is 4%, your real return is only about 1%. Percentage calculations need context regarding purchasing power.
- Taxes: Income, sales, and capital gains taxes are all calculated as percentages. The tax rate directly reduces the amount you keep. Understanding the tax implications is crucial for accurate net results in financial scenarios.
- Data Interpretation Context: Percentages can be presented misleadingly. A small percentage improvement might sound insignificant, but if the base is enormous, the absolute change could be substantial. Always consider the absolute numbers alongside percentages for a complete picture.
